RemoteApp with no login

Is it possible to have RemoteApp be completely publicly available with no login?  We have a client who because of corporate polices won't accept our ClickOnce application (they don't allow auto-updating applications and since our ClickOnce app does automatically update when a new version is available it is not allowed).  My next thought was to publish the app as a RemoteApp and they just access that (we'd have to manually update the RemoteApp when any new version is available but we can automate that).

Ideally, I want this to not require any login of any type for RemoteApp.  The RemoteApp server will be safely in a DMZ, Firewall rules will only allow connections to the server from our client site over a VPN we will create between the client and ourselves, and our application has its own login method (not AD integrated).  So ideally, I'd like to deploy the RemoteApp where the client's users just launch the RemoteApp, enter the application's credentials and that is it.  No need to enter any domain logins/etc.

I've been playing with this trying to make every setting I can find say "everyone" can access it, but it always still requests a domain login/password.  Is there any way to basically make the RemoteApp "public" and not require login/password at all for RemoteApp?
